[Confirmed Lineup] Surprise Midfield Inclusion As Wenger Makes Mass Changes


The lineups are in for Arsenal’s Premier League home tie against Middlesbrough and Arsene Wenger has made four big selection changes to the that team swept aside Ludogorets 6-0 in midweek.

Petr Cech returns between the stick while Kieran Gibbs is dropped for Nacho Monreal, while Hector Bellerin continues on the right with first choice centre back pairing Shkodran Mustafi and Laurent Koscielny in the middle.

Arsenal have a new look midfield pairing with Francis Coquelin and Mohamed Elneny in midfield with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ain missing out to Alex Iwobi on the left. Theo Walcott starts once more on the right, with hat trick hero Mesut Özil as the No.10. The trio supports Alexis Sanchez who keeps his place in the starting lineup.
